Overview

We are seeking a highly skilled and experienced Project Management Consultant to join our team. The Project Management Consultant will be responsible for overseeing and managing projects throughout their lifecycle, from initiation to completion. The ideal candidate will possess strong leadership, communication, and organizational skills, with a proven track record in delivering successful projects across various industries. This role requires the ability to collaborate effectively with clients, stakeholders, and project teams to ensure projects are delivered on time, within scope, and within budget.

Roles And Responsibilities

  • Project Planning and Initiation:
    • Collaborate with clients to define project objectives, scope, deliverables, and timelines.
    • Develop comprehensive project plans, including resource allocation, budgeting, and risk management strategies.
    • Conduct feasibility studies, stakeholder analysis, and project assessments to determine project viability.
  • Project Execution and Monitoring:
    • Lead project teams in executing project tasks according to established plans and methodologies (e.g., Agile, Waterfall).
    • Monitor project progress, track milestones, and ensure adherence to project schedules and budgets.
    • Implement project controls, performance metrics, and reporting mechanisms to keep stakeholders informed.
  • Risk Management and Issue Resolution:
    • Identify potential risks, issues, and dependencies that may impact project outcomes.
    • Develop risk mitigation strategies and contingency plans to address project challenges proactively.
    • Facilitate resolution of project issues, conflicts, and roadblocks in collaboration with project teams and stakeholders.
  • Quality Assurance and Deliverable Management:
    • Ensure deliverables meet quality standards, client requirements, and project expectations.
    • Conduct regular reviews, inspections, and audits to validate project deliverables and outputs.
    • Implement quality assurance processes and continuous improvement initiatives throughout the project lifecycle.
  • Client Communication and Stakeholder Engagement:
    • Serve as the primary point of contact for clients and stakeholders, providing regular updates and progress reports.
    • Manage stakeholder expectations, communications, and relationships throughout the project duration.
    • Conduct stakeholder meetings, workshops, and presentations to discuss project status, milestones, and next steps.
